Raby Castle

This 14th century castle has been home to Lord Barnard's family since 1626. 

Impressive

Highlights include an impressive gateway, a vast hall, a medieval kitchen and a Victorian octagonal drawing room. The rooms display fine furniture, artworks and elaborate architecture.

Tearooms

Enjoy the deer park, walled gardens and carriage collection. Sample the menu in the stable tearooms. Events take place throughout the summer
